Core EV Power Systems Electrician Responsibilities
As part of your core responsibilities, you’ll install and configure power distribution systems for EV charging stations, run conduit and wire for load balancing and grid tie-ins, and monitor electrical loads. You’ll also ensure code compliance, install switchgear, transformers, and meters, and coordinate with utility providers. Supporting remote diagnostics and system upgrades will also be part of your duties. Other technical duties include performing load calculations, troubleshooting system issues, and performing preventative maintenance. Regional project specifics and adherence to safety protocols are also crucial aspects of this role.
Required Experience & Skills
To qualify for this position, you must be a licensed journeyman electrician with a strong knowledge of EVSE infrastructure and grid interconnection. Experience with transformers and switchgear, strong wiring and installation skills, and the ability to read one-line diagrams and permits are also essential. You should have completed OSHA safety training and have at least 3-5 years of experience as an EV Power Systems Electrician. Essential certifications include NABCEP PV Installation Professional and NFPA 70E Electrical Safety.
